It's been a year since I've opened Quest. I got a new computer in that time. Just downloaded Quest onto the new computer and tried to load and play the game I had been working on. It freezes the program and gives me the following errors:

Error launching game: Could not load file or assembly 'CefSharp.Core.dll' or one of its dependencies. The specified module could not be found.

Error launching game: Object reference not set to an instance of an object.

System.NullReferenceException: Object reference not set to an instance of an object.
   at TextAdventures.Quest.PlayerHTML._Closure$__84-0._Lambda$__1()
   at TextAdventures.Quest.PlayerHTML.ClearBuffer()
   at TextAdventures.Quest.Player._Lambda$__122-0() ```

I don't know if it's a bug in my actual program that I never fixed last year, or a problem with updating the software or changing computers. But it's been a long time and I don't really remember anything about the program or even the coding language, much less what I was working on last time I was working on it, or where the problem might be, or how to fix it. Can anyone help me figure out what these errors mean and how to resolve them?


K.V.

It sounds like you need to download the installation file again, uninstall what you've got, then install from the new download.

CefSharp has to do with the embedded Chromium browser. If you're missing that, there was probably a problem with the download.
